Imagine launching your WordPress website in mere minutes, bypassing the complexities of manual installations and database configurations. With a one-click WordPress install, this dream becomes a reality. This streamlined approach empowers both beginners and seasoned developers to get online quickly and efficiently, focusing on creating content and engaging with their audience rather than wrestling with technical hurdles. This guide explores the benefits, processes, and considerations of using a one-click WordPress install.
What is a One-Click WordPress Install?
Understanding the Concept
A one-click WordPress install is a simplified process offered by many web hosting providers that automates the installation of the WordPress content management system (CMS). Instead of manually creating databases, uploading files, and configuring settings, the hosting provider handles everything behind the scenes, allowing you to install WordPress with just a few clicks. It’s like ordering a pizza – you select your options, and the hosting provider delivers a ready-to-use WordPress site.
How It Works
The process generally involves logging into your hosting account control panel (like cPanel, Plesk, or a custom interface), locating the one-click WordPress installer (often found under “Website Tools” or “Software”), and following the on-screen prompts. These prompts typically include:
- Choosing a domain name for your website.
- Entering a site name and description.
- Creating an administrator username and password.
Once you’ve provided this information, the installer takes care of the rest, automatically configuring your database, installing WordPress files, and setting up basic configurations. Within minutes, your WordPress site is ready to be customized.
Common Platforms Offering One-Click Installs
Many web hosting providers offer one-click WordPress installs. Some of the most popular include:
- Bluehost
- HostGator
- SiteGround
- DreamHost
- InMotion Hosting
- GoDaddy
These providers often feature specialized WordPress hosting plans that include optimized server configurations and additional features specifically tailored for WordPress websites.
Benefits of Using One-Click WordPress Install
Speed and Convenience
The primary benefit is the significant time savings. A manual WordPress installation can take 30 minutes to an hour (or even longer for beginners), whereas a one-click install typically takes just a few minutes. This allows you to quickly launch your website and start creating content.
Ease of Use for Beginners
One-click installers eliminate the technical complexities that can be daunting for newcomers. You don’t need to be a database expert or a server administrator to get started. The intuitive interface guides you through the process, making WordPress accessible to everyone.
Reduced Risk of Errors
Manual installations involve multiple steps, each with the potential for errors. Mistakes during database creation or file configuration can lead to installation failures and website issues. A one-click installer automates these processes, minimizing the risk of human error.
Automated Updates and Security
Many hosting providers that offer one-click installs also provide automated WordPress updates and security patches. This ensures your website remains secure and up-to-date without requiring manual intervention. This is a significant advantage, as outdated WordPress installations are vulnerable to security threats. According to a Sucuri report, outdated plugins and themes were a major entry point for website hacks in 2023.
Step-by-Step Guide to One-Click WordPress Installation (Example: cPanel)
Logging into Your Hosting Account
Access your web hosting account through your hosting provider’s website. Locate the login area, usually labeled “Login,” “Account,” or “Customer Portal.” Enter your username and password.
Locating the One-Click Installer
Once logged in, look for the cPanel interface. This is a common control panel used by many hosting providers. Within cPanel, search for a section labeled “Software” or “Website Tools.” Common installer options include “Softaculous Apps Installer” or “WordPress Installer.”
Configuring the WordPress Installation
Click on the WordPress installer icon. You’ll be presented with a screen to configure your WordPress installation. The key settings include:
- Choose Domain: Select the domain name where you want to install WordPress. If you have multiple domains, ensure you choose the correct one.
- Directory: Leave this field blank to install WordPress in the root directory of your domain (e.g., `yourdomain.com`). If you want to install it in a subdirectory (e.g., `yourdomain.com/blog`), enter the subdirectory name here.
- Site Name: Enter the name of your website. This will be displayed in the website header.
- Site Description: Provide a brief description of your website.
- Admin Username: Choose a strong and unique username for your WordPress administrator account. Avoid using “admin” as it is a common target for hackers.
- Admin Password: Create a strong and secure password for your administrator account. Use a combination of uppercase and lowercase letters, numbers, and symbols.
- Admin Email: Enter a valid email address. This email will be used for password recovery and important notifications.
- Select Language: Choose the language for your WordPress installation.
Completing the Installation
Review all the settings to ensure they are correct. Then, click the “Install” button. The installer will automatically create the database, upload the WordPress files, and configure the necessary settings. The installation process typically takes a few minutes. Once completed, you’ll receive a confirmation message with your WordPress login details. Save these details in a secure location.
Post-Installation Steps
- Log in to your WordPress dashboard using the administrator username and password you created.
- Change your default theme. WordPress installs with a default theme. Head to “Appearance -> Themes” in your dashboard to install and activate a theme more aligned with your brand.
- Install necessary plugins. Plugins extend the functionality of WordPress. Some essential plugins include:
Yoast SEO (for search engine optimization)
Akismet Anti-Spam (for spam protection)
Contact Form 7 (for creating contact forms)
Wordfence Security (for enhanced security)
- Configure your website settings, including permalinks, time zone, and reading settings.
- Start creating content, pages, and posts.
Considerations Before Using One-Click Install
Hosting Provider Reliability
Choose a reputable hosting provider with a proven track record of reliability and performance. Look for providers that offer excellent customer support and uptime guarantees. Read reviews and compare different hosting plans before making a decision. A study by Pingdom found that some hosting providers have significantly better uptime performance than others.
Security Implications
While one-click installs simplify the process, they can sometimes introduce security vulnerabilities if not properly managed. Ensure your hosting provider offers security features like:
- Automatic WordPress updates
- Firewall protection
- Malware scanning
It’s also crucial to use strong passwords and keep your plugins and themes updated to protect your website from potential threats. Regularly backup your website to prevent data loss in case of security breaches or other issues.
Customization Limitations
While one-click installers provide a basic WordPress installation, they may not offer advanced customization options. If you require specific server configurations or complex settings, a manual installation may be more appropriate. Consider your technical skills and requirements before choosing an installation method. Some hosting providers offer managed WordPress hosting, which combines the ease of a one-click install with advanced customization options and expert support.
Conclusion
One-click WordPress installs offer a fast, convenient, and user-friendly way to launch your website. By understanding the process, benefits, and considerations outlined in this guide, you can make an informed decision and take advantage of this streamlined approach to get your WordPress site online quickly and efficiently. Remember to choose a reliable hosting provider, prioritize security, and customize your website to meet your specific needs. With a one-click install, you can focus on creating engaging content and building your online presence without getting bogged down in technical complexities.
